This position is in the Qaulity control area for Cummins Emissions Solutions and as you can guess it is in the extreme detail category as we only have a tolerance of less than 6 milimeters (or milmitres for you folks across the pond) half above the nominal distance and half below for the parts that we are constucting. When you are working with steel and welding operations this is not a whole lot of room to play with.

{please keep reading their will be star wars stuff at the bottom I promise}

What we make are the Cummins Particulate Filters for the medium to heavy duty Truck and tractor industry such as you would see on Semi tractors, constuction equipment, city buses and agricultural use as well. This product ( a hi-tech muffler in laymans terms) is reported to be capable of capturing up to 90% of diesel fuel emissions.
